Output 366f3ee1d0363ebba3c61fc88fa25387dd20e47b834c36f701cd60ac71ccec61:1

value
28007228
script pubkey
OP_0 OP_PUSHBYTES_20 605f14ccd57cbdf8b9c2710c09039bc56186042d
address
bc1qvp03fnx40j7l3wwzwyxqjqumc4scvppdh4ww9a
transaction
366f3ee1d0363ebba3c61fc88fa25387dd20e47b834c36f701cd60ac71ccec61
confirmations
177895
spent
true